This Condo has been in the family since it was first built. And it was in desperate need of being renovated. The kitchen was isolated from the rest of the condo. The laundry space was an old pantry that was converted. We needed to open up the kitchen to living space to make the space feel larger. By changing the entrance to the first guest bedroom and turn in a den with a wonderful walk in owners closet. Then we removed the old owners closet, adding that space to the guest bath to allow us to make the shower bigger. In addition giving the vanity more space. The rest of the condo was updated. The master bath again was tight, but by removing walls and changing door swings we were able to make it functional and beautiful all that the same time.

Beautiful blue and white long hall bathroom with double sinks and a shower at the end wall. The light chevron floor tile pattern adds subtle interest and contrasts with the dark blue vanity. The classic white marble countertop is timeless. The accent wall of blue tile at the back wall of the shower add drama to the space. Tile from Wayne Tile in NJ. Square white window in shower brings in natural light that is reflected into the space by simple rectangular mirrors and white walls. Above the mirrors are lights in silver and black.

The guest bath features floor to ceiling glass tile in a calming sage green, while the freestanding cabinets are a bright white. Behind the freestanding tub teak shutters open to the bathroom's private garden and outdoor shower. The walls are lava rock and the shower head is a custom stone waterfall. The teak mirrors are framed by glass pendants. The gold fixtures add a pop of glamour to the all white vanities and the soft green of the shower. The shower floor is gray pebbles to compliment the gray floor and the lava rock outside in the garden.

Perspective 3D d'une salle d'eau pour des clients faisant construire. Ils souhaitaient un style bord de mer, mais sans bleu, et aimaient beaucoup la voile. Nous avons donc choisi un parquet style pont de bateau en teck, que nous avons agrémenté de carrelage hexagonal blanc pour donner un effet de vague et casser la couleur marron. Ils ne souhaitaient pas de meuble sous vasque imposant et nous avons donc opté pour des planches de bois brut.

This little coastal bathroom is full of fun surprises. The NativeTrails shell vessel sink is our star. The blue toned herringbone shower wall tiles are interesting and lovely. The blues bring out the blue chips in the terrazzo flooring which reminds us of a sandy beach. The half glass panel keeps the room feeling spacious and open when bathing. The herringbone pattern on the beachy wood floating vanity connects to the shower pattern. We get a little bling with the copper mirror and vanity hardware. Fun baskets add a tidy look to the open linen closet. A once dark and generic guest bathroom has been transformed into a bright, welcoming, and beachy space that makes a statement.
